I understand that when trying to download apps, your iPhone asks for Touch ID, then your password, and repeats this process. I'm happy to provide some help for this issue.
I recommend first forcing the App Store to close, and then restarting your iPhone:

If you continue having this issue, make sure that you do not have any outstanding billing issues that could prevent you from downloading new apps:

And sign out of your Apple ID and back in again if this isn't the case. To sign out of your Apple ID:
- Go to Settings.
- Tap [Your Name].
- Tap iTunes & App Store.
- Tap your Apple ID.
- Tap Sign Out.
To sign in with your Apple ID:

Before you begin, update your device to the latest iOS.
When you use iOS 10.3 or later, you sign in to iCloud, the iTunes & App Store, iMessage, FaceTime, and your other Apple services in one place.
- Go to Settings.
- Tap Sign in to your [device].
- Enter your Apple ID and password.
- If you protect your account with two-factor authentication, enter the six-digit verification code and complete sign in.
